The Labradoodle is another designer breed that is a mix between a Labrador Retriever and a Poodle. Like the Goldendoodle, they have a curly or wavy coat that is hypoallergenic. Labradoodles come in a variety of colors, including cream, black, chocolate, and red. They are similar in size to the Goldendoodle, with males typically weighing between 50-65 pounds and females weighing between 45-60 pounds.
Labadoodles are known for their friendly and sociable nature. They are intelligent and easy to train, making them great family pets. Like Goldendoodles, Labradoodles are also good with children and other pets. They are active dogs that require regular exercise and mental stimulation to keep them happy and healthy.
The Bernedoodle is a mix between a Bernese Mountain Dog and a Poodle. They have a curly or wavy coat that can be tricolor, with black, white, and brown markings. Bernedoodles are larger than Goldendoodles, with males weighing between 70-90 pounds and females weighing between 55-75 pounds.
Bernedoodles are gentle giants that are known for their calm and loving demeanor. They are great with families and do well with children and other pets. Bernedoodles are intelligent and easy to train, but they can be a bit stubborn at times. They are loyal companions that love to be around their family members.
The Sheepadoodle is a mix between a Old English Sheepdog and a Poodle. They have a shaggy coat that is typically black and white, similar to that of a sheep. Sheepadoodles are large dogs, with males weighing between 60-80 pounds and females weighing between 50-70 pounds.
Sheepadoodles are affectionate and friendly dogs that are great with families. They are intelligent and easy to train, but they can be a bit independent at times. Sheepadoodles are good with children and other pets, and they form strong bonds with their owners. They are loyal and protective, making them great watchdogs.
